Tanzanian police restrain millionaire Kenyan music mogul Joe Kariuki over 300 million fraud

Candy ‘n’ Candy Records boss Joe Kariuki was arrested in Tanzania on July 2nd 2017 and has been under the watchful eye of Tanzanian authorities ever since.

Joe was apprehended in Longido District for defrauding a certain Yusuf Mohamed a whopping Tsh 300 million or Kes 13.9 million. Arusha court threw out his fraud case but Tanzanian police immediately arrested him again outside the courthouse.

“Baada ya kufikishwa mahakamani shauri lake lilifutwa juzi kisha polisi walimkamata nje ya mahakama na kumpeleka kituo cha polisi Longido ambako anashikiliwa,” Joe Kariuki’s lawyer John Malya was quoted by Bongo5.

Joe’s lawyer said police told him that another victim had stepped forth with new evidence and that his case would be reopened.

The millionaire Kenyan music mogul got sick while under the custody of Tanzanian police, he was admitted at a hospital in Arusha under tight security from the police.

Tanzanian prosecutors on Monday July 31st read new charges to Joe while he was still receiving treatment at the hospital in Arusha.

Tanzanian news outlets report that Joe Kariuki is still admitted in hospital even though they didn’t elaborate about his state of health.
